One of the most beloved script tattoo fonts is the Cursive style, renowned for its elegance and fluidity. Cursive fonts feature sweeping, interconnected letters that exude a sense of grace and sophistication. This font style is often associated with romantic or emotional tattoos, as its flowing strokes lend a poetic quality to the written words.
Incorporating a cursive tattoo font into a design infuses it with an air of timeless charm. The graceful curves and loops of cursive lettering create an enchanting visual rhythm, enhancing the overall allure of the tattoo. Whether adorning a poignant quote or a sentimental message, cursive tattoo fonts elevate the expression through their inherently elegant nature.
Lavanderia: This delicate cursive font evokes vintage charm, ideal for expressing nostalgic sentiments or classic quotes.
Grand Hotel: With its luxurious flourishes, Grand Hotel adds an element of opulence to script tattoos, making it suitable for conveying grandeur or elegance in written words.
Contrasting the fluidity of cursive fonts, Bold tattoo fonts are designed to make a bold statement. Featuring strong lines and impactful lettering, bold fonts command attention and convey assertiveness. These fonts are commonly used for names or simple slogans that demand prominence and visibility.
When to Choose a Bold Font for Your Tattoo
When Emphasizing Strength: Bold tattoo fonts are ideal for highlighting powerful words or affirmations that exude strength and resilience.
For Name Tattoos: When commemorating significant names or dates, opting for a bold font ensures clear legibility and emphasis on personal significance.

After getting a new script tattoo, proper care is essential to ensure the tattoo heals well and maintains its vibrancy. Understanding the aftercare process, both in the immediate days following the tattoo session and in the long term, is crucial for preserving the integrity of your inked artwork.
In the initial days following the application of your script tattoo, it's vital to prioritize diligent care to facilitate proper healing. This involves adhering to a routine that focuses on cleanliness and moisturization.
Cleaning your fresh tattoo with a mild, fragrance-free soap and lukewarm water multiple times a day helps prevent infection and promotes healing. Gently patting the area dry with a clean, soft cloth is advisable to avoid irritation.
Moisturizing your tattoo with an unscented, alcohol-free lotion or specialized tattoo aftercare product is essential to keep the skin hydrated and aid in the healing process. Applying a thin layer of moisturizer several times a day helps prevent excessive dryness and itching while promoting optimal healing.
Beyond the initial healing phase, maintaining the vibrancy of your script tattoo requires ongoing care and protection. Sun exposure, in particular, can significantly impact the longevity of your tattoo's clarity and color saturation.
Shielding your tattoo from prolonged sun exposure is imperative for preventing fading and discoloration. When spending time outdoors, especially during peak sunlight hours, applying a broad-spectrum sunscreen with high SPF directly onto your tattooed skin provides crucial protection against harmful UV rays.
In cases where some fading or loss of vibrancy occurs over time due to sun exposure or natural aging of the skin, scheduling periodic touch-up sessions with a skilled tattoo artist can restore the original luster and definition of your script tattoo.
